In Exchange 2007, cannot recieved duplicated email,  DeliveryTO table not being updated.
Hi, We have an application which has a feature to recover emails. It worked fine with CGPro. Recently I migrated our mail system to Exchange 2007 and the feature stoped working. I tracked the message , and it shows DUPLICATEDELIVER for the email I want to reocvery. Then I changed two keys in Registry as follows: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\MSExchangeIS\<Server Name>\<Private/Public-Guid>\Track Duplicates changed to 1 hour H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\MSExchangeIS\<Server Name>\<Private/Public-Guid>\Background Cleanup (in msecs). Changed to 60000 So I believe entires in DeliveryTO table will age out in an hour. So I waited for an hour and tried to recovery an email which was sent to me an hours ago, still doesn't work, neither does when try to recovery an email recievedfew days ago. I also tried to setup "keep deleted items" for 0 days on Exchange server, thendeleted someemails, then deletedthem from deleted items, wait for a few days, try to recover them, still not working, The tracked log still shows DUPLICATEDELIVER. Information Store has been restarted after I changed the registry. I suspected the DeliveryTO table not being updated properly? How can I know the DeliveryTO table has been updated or not? Thanks,

Hi Elvis, I doubt it is the self-developed software. What I have done: I can recover emails sent 8 days ago which means the DeliveredToTable got purged for those entries which are 7 (or 8) days agao. but I setup the registry key for Track Duplicates is setup to 1 which means 1 hour. 1.enabled the event log to medium for Background Cleanup 2, I can see from the event log Cleanup of the DeliveredTo table for database 'First Storage Group\Mailbox Database' was successful. 8886 entries were purged (out of 8921 entries visited). 3. created a second database in the same Storage Group 4. moved myself maibox to the new database 5. unmounted the new database and mounted back the database 6 waited for at least half a day and recieved a few eamils 7. checked in the event log: got Cleanup of the DeliveredTo table for database 'First Storage Group\test duplicate' was successful. 0 entries were purged (out of 0 entries visited). This is not right. This mens the DeliveredTo table has not entries but I did recieved quite a few emails 8.Tried to recover an email which sent two hours ago with our application, it didn't work. 9tried to recover an email which sent before moving my mailbox, it worked, which means during moving the mailbox, the DeliveredTo table got clean up.
